How much do sr windows administrator j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for sr windows administrator in the United States is $58.37,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$50.96 and $63.94 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Sr Windows Administrator do?

A Sr Windows Administrator is responsible for managing and maintaining Windows-based servers and systems within an organization. Their duties include installing, configuring, and troubleshooting Windows servers, ensuring system security, managing user accounts, and performing regular backups. They also oversee software updates and patches, monitor system performance, and provide technical support to end users. Senior administrators may also design and implement system policies and procedures to optimize IT infrastructure. Their expertise ensures the reliability, security, and efficiency of an organization's IT environ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Sr Windows Administr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sr Windows Administrator, you need deep expertise in Windows Server environments, Active Directory, and networking concepts, typically backed by a bachelor's degree in IT or related field. Proficiency with tools like PowerShell, virtualization platforms (e.g., Hyper-V, VMware), and cert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Windows Server or Azure Administrator are highly valuable.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you excel in this role. These skills and qualities are crucial for ensuring system reliability, security, and efficient collaboration within technical teams.

What are some common challenges faced by Sr Windows Administrators when managing large-scale enterprise environments?

Sr Windows Administrators often encounter challenges such as overseeing complex Active Directory structures, ensuring consistent patch management across hundreds or thousands of devices, and maintaining system uptime while applying critical updates. Balancing security requirements with user accessibility can also be demanding, especially in environments with diverse teams and remote users. Effective communication and collaboration with network, security, and application teams are essential to ensure seamless operations and rapid issue resolution.

What is the difference between Sr Windows Administrator vs Windows Systems Engineer?

AspectSr Windows AdministratorWindows Systems Engineer
CertificationsMicrosoft Certified: Windows Server, MCSEMicrosoft Certified: Windows Server, MCSE, or related certifications
Work EnvironmentData centers, enterprise IT teams, support rolesDesign, deployment, and optimization of Windows infrastructure
Employer & Industry UsageCorporate IT departments, government agencies, large enterprisesIT consulting firms, enterprise IT teams, cloud service providers

The main difference between a Sr Windows Administrator and a Windows Systems Engineer lies in their focus. The Sr Windows Administrator primarily manages and maintains existing Windows environments, ensuring stability and security. In contrast, the Windows Systems Engineer is more involved in designing, implementing, and optimizing Windows infrastructure. Both roles require similar certifications and often work within the same industries, but their responsibilities differ in scope and focus.
